Abstract

The blood sampl'es of Small Tailed Han sheep reared in Beijing suburb area and the nucleus flock with high fecundity of Small Tailed Han sheep were collected to detect the FecB mutation of BMPR-IB gene by PCR-RFLP and analysis the effects of different BMPR-IB genotypes on litter size of the ewes in the two flocks as well as the effects of different genotypes on growth and development in offspring of the nucleus flock. The results showed that genotype frequencies of BB ,B + and + + of BMPR-IB gene was 0. 34 ,0. 56 and 0. 10 in Small Tailed Han sheep reared in Beijing suburb area,respectively,and was 0. 47 ,0. 48 and 0. 05 in the core group with high fecundity Respectively. The litter size of Small Tail Han sheep reared in Beijing suburb area with BB,B + and + + genotypes was 2. 72 ,2. 16 and 1. 74 , while litter size of ewes with BB ,B + and + + genotypes in core group was 3. 20 , 2.57 and 2. 07 , respectively. Before 90 days, average daily gain ( ADG ) of the lambs with different genotypes reached a maximum,especially in lambs with B + genotype. After 120 days, the growth rate of lambs with different genotypes showed no significant difference. Concerning the body size index, the growth of body length and chest circumference were more than body height in female lambs with B + genotype which showed better growth potential. These results suggested that BMPR-IB gene was the major gene affecting litter size in Small Tail Han sheep, and was no obvious influences on growth and development. The Fee mutation could be used to breed new strain of Small Tailed Han sheep with super prolificacy, as well as to breed new sheep breeds with high prolificacy and in mutton production.
